EmergeOrtho & General Health System Victims of Ransomware Attacks

HIPAA Journal

EmergeOrtho, a North Carolina orthopedic practice, has recently notified 75,200 patients that some of their protected health information has been accessed by unauthorized individuals. The forensic investigation confirmed that the threat actors behind the attack had accessed files containing patients’ protected health information.

Bonus Features – April 21, 2024 – 89% of physicians said generative AI vendors need to be transparent about where info comes from, 73% of consumers expect a 4-star rating before they’ll engage with a provider, plus 21 more stories

Healthcare IT Today

The 2024 Healthcare Reputation Report from Reputation found 73% of consumers demand a minimum 4-star rating to even consider engaging with a provider. Additionally, patient feedback volume has increased 150% in five years. Less than 26% of patients said they’d experienced a high level of care , according to a report from Soliant.
